The War Games Pass that comes with the LE doesn’t come with the bonus content that the ones who buy the Pass separately will get. BS Angel has confirmed this.
The Recruit Armor that was implied to be exlusive to the LE has now been confirmed to be the default armor for all spartans. You are now only getting a skin.
The Specializations that you thought were exclusive to the LE? They are now available with any preorder of either edition. It’s a GameStop exclusive though, and doesn’t apply to US GameStops.
